3 is what percent of 75?
vovikov84 [41]

Answer:

4%

Step-by-step explanation:

First, we turn this into a fraction:

3/75 = 1/25 = 4%

So 3 is 4% of 75

The function g is given in three equivalent forms.<br> Which form most quickly reveals the vertex?
Nadusha1986 [10]

Answer:

Option A. g(x)= \frac{1}{2}(x-8)^2-8

Step-by-step explanation:

<u><em>The complete question is</em></u>

The function g is given in three equivalent forms.

Which form most quickly reveals the vertex?

A)g(x)= 1/2(x-8)^2-8

B)g(x)= 1/2(x-12)(x-4)

C)g(x)= 1/2x^2-8x+24

we know that

The equation of a quadratic function in vertex form is equal to

y=a(x-h)^2+k

where

a is the leading coefficient

(h,k) is the vertex of the function

In this problem, the option A is the equation of the function in vertex form

we have

g(x)= \frac{1}{2}(x-8)^2-8

where the vertex is the point (8,-8)

therefore

Option A
